What's Behind Hamilton's Ferrari Resurgence?

Lewis Hamilton has stormed back with Ferrari, winning in Barcelona to mount a 2026 title bid. Here is how new regulations, a sharper engineering bond, and an off-track reset fueled his dramatic turnaround.

Lewis Hamilton’s Spanish Grand Prix victory ended a nearly two-year win drought and delivered Ferrari its first triumph with the seven-time champion. Just 41 points behind Kimi Antonelli after seven rounds, he has converted a nightmare 2025 into a genuine title charge.

Why it matters:

  • Hamilton’s resurgence rewrites the narrative that his best days were behind him, inserting a 41-year-old veteran directly into a young man’s title fight.
  • For Ferrari, the turnaround validates its blockbuster signing and revives serious championship hopes.

The details:

  • Car philosophy: The 2026 regulations produced narrower, more agile machinery rewarding an aggressive style. Hamilton instantly bonded with the car in testing, saying it finally “talks to me.”
  • Design influence: Hamilton helped shape the SF-26 with chassis director Loic Serra, pushing innovations like the “Macarena” rear wing.
  • Engineering chemistry: New race engineer Carlo Santi brought calmer communication Hamilton likens to his bond with “Bono” Bonnington.
  • Personal reset: After battling a lingering 2025 preseason injury, Hamilton rebuilt himself over the winter, citing a happier personal life as central to restored confidence.

What's next:

  • With Ferrari’s SF-26 now the cornering benchmark, Hamilton carries momentum into the Austrian Grand Prix.
  • If this form holds, the title race could become a duel between Hamilton and the generation he once inspired.
